Integrating Technology in Dance Education

The integration of technology in dance education is becoming increasingly prevalent. Virtual reality and artificial intelligence are being utilized to create immersive learning experiences, enabling students to engage with dance practice in unprecedented ways. For example, VR can simulate studio environments, allowing students to rehearse in diverse settings. This tech-forward approach not only enhances learning but also broadens access to top-notch dance training globally.

Revolutionizing Dance Through Contemporary Creation

The influence of choreographers like Mats Ek on modern dance is profound, inspiring a new generation of dancers to push the boundaries of creativity. Future trends in dance creation are leaning toward interdisciplinary fusion, combining dance with other art forms such as visual arts, film, and music. This synergistic approach enriches performances, making them more dynamic and reflective of contemporary culture.

Global Collaborations in Dance

Global collaborations are setting new standards for artistic exchange and innovation. By bringing diverse cultural perspectives together, dance companies can create more inclusive and varied works. The Martha Graham Dance Company’s global tour exemplifies how cross-cultural exchanges can rejuvenate traditional methods and introduce new audiences to historical dance legacies.

Case Studies: Successful Cross-Disciplinary Approaches

Many prestigious dance institutions are already incorporating cross-disciplinary modules into their curriculum. For example, partnering with film departments to offer joint projects or utilizing digital storytelling techniques has led to more versatile and expressive dancers. These programs prepare students for the modern workforce, where adaptability and creative problem-solving are crucial skills.

Frequently Asked Questions

How important is technology in dance education?

Technology plays a crucial role in modern dance education. It facilitates access to resources, enhances the learning experience with interactive tools, and allows for remote instruction.

What are the benefits of interdisciplinary approaches?

Interdisciplinary approaches promote creativity and innovation, allowing dancers to explore new artistic vocabularies and develop a more nuanced understanding of different art forms.

How can one find opportunities for global dance collaborations?

Networking through workshops, festivals, and online platforms like social media and specialized forums can lead to opportunities for global dance collaborations. Participating in international dance conferences or joining world-renowned dance organizations also opens doors for talent exchange.
